The National Monuments Service's description

In level pasture, on the valley floor on the N side of the Roughty River. This possible rath is not visible at ground level, apart from a shallow depression (L c. 35m) NW-NE which may indicate the line of a fosse. It is indicated as a circular enclosure (diam. c. 25m) on the 1846 OS 6-inch map and as a roughly circular enclosure (diam. c. 30m) on the 1895 OS 6-inch map. According to local information, it was levelled when the surrounding field boundaries were removed.

The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Kerry. Volume I: South-West Kerry'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 2009).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
